Understanding Construction Financing
It's essential for developers to understand construction financing under property development finance. This type of financing offers specialised loans designed to cover all stages of construction, starting from acquiring the land to completing the project. These loans usually have flexible schedules for releasing funds as construction progresses. Developers need to show that their project is feasible by presenting detailed plans, financial forecasts, and market analysis to secure financing. Lenders evaluate risks linked to construction, like potential delays or higher costs, and might ask for collateral or various guarantees. Understanding property development finance is key to keeping projects on course with adequate funding for successful completion.
